## Webhook retries — quick recap for the sync

So Fennelworks delivery has been double-firing when a customer endpoint times out right at the edge. Plan: switch to exponential backoff with jitter, cap attempts, and dedupe on delivery ID. Marit's already prototyped this in the Quillhook service. The tuning constants we're proposing are below.

constants for bawif-kawif:
QUOTAS = {
    "ulaael": 5,
    "holael": 10,
}

When the cache invalidation worker at Pellingford loses its service account, stale product entries accumulate quickly, so recover access promptly. First, confirm the account lockout in the admin console, then purge the pending invalidation queue to prevent duplicate flushes. Re-authenticate the worker using the recovery flow; it will prompt for the stored passphrase before reissuing credentials. Do not rotate the signing key during this step. Enter the recovery passphrase exactly as written below.

unlock words, kajef-kadug: sorys-pelax-lamael-tamvan-briiel-novdor-fenwyn-tamdor-oliion-keleth-julok-belion-ralok

While reviewing the Lanternrock device-firmware pipeline, I found the staging channel's signing vault locked itself after last week's key rotation. The auto-unseal hook in the publish job fails silently, so candidate builds for the Ostrel gateway line queue indefinitely. I've traced it to the rotation script clearing the cached unseal material without re-registering it. Until the fix lands, maintainers must unseal manually before approving any channel promotion. The recovery passphrase for manual unseal follows.

recovery phrase for fajep-yaweg: gilath-sorox-wenius-rusdor-keliel-zorius

- [ ] **Step 7: Breaker override escrow.** After sealing the signing keys for the Tallgrove upstream API circuit breaker, confirm the support team can force the breaker open during a full outage. The override bundle lives in the sealed escrow drawer and is useless without its unlock phrase. Two ceremony witnesses must initial this step before proceeding. The escrow bundle is decrypted with the recovery passphrase that follows.

vault phrase of kahip-kahop = holath-quenmir